Transaction 57634e77d8fe2c82362c7934dbfdf02d9422279e445a3e3f3eca45f866be07bf

1 Input
2 Outputs
  • 57634e77d8fe2c82362c7934dbfdf02d9422279e445a3e3f3eca45f866be07bf:0
  • value  107343001
    address  bc1q09jfd2xe8hy79qfe2nasccdnhaa6m4da0mtx8l
  • 57634e77d8fe2c82362c7934dbfdf02d9422279e445a3e3f3eca45f866be07bf:1
  • value  13982328
    address  3CB9ADSvvaoJLJK4ki7uW8vtKp71NqyX9F